The Lufthansa Group announced Wednesday that it will add new European summer destinations to the flight schedule of Lufthansa Airlines, Swiss International Air Lines and Brussels Airlines.
Lufthansa Airlines will offer a new route between Frankfurt and Lamezia Terme (Calabria) starting April 6, 2025. The airline will fly to southern Italy every Sunday and from May 1, 2025, also on Thursdays.
Figari in Corsica (France) will also be new in the schedule for Lufthansa Airlines from Frankfurt. The Corsican city will be served once a week (Saturday) from May 17, 2025.

Swiss International Air Lines will offer flights to the Croatian city of Dubrovnik from Zurich from April 17, 2025. The historic city will be accessible up to five times a week during the summer.
Brussels Airlines is offering flights to Funchal (Madeira/Portugal) from Brussels for the first time. The flight will be available once a week (Saturday) from April 5, 2025.
The Lufthansa Group airlines will thus offer their guests over 12,000 weekly connections to over 300 destinations in more than 100 countries via their hubs in Germany, Switzerland, Austria and Belgium.
